Can You Wear a Watch With a Pacemaker?

A pacemaker is a small, implanted medical device that helps regulate heart rhythm by sending electrical pulses. For individuals with a pacemaker, a common question arises regarding the safety of wearing watches, as electronic devices can potentially interfere with its function.

Safety of Different Watch Types

Traditional analog watches, which operate mechanically or with a simple battery, generally pose no known risk to pacemakers. They do not emit significant electromagnetic fields that could interfere with implanted cardiac devices. Standard digital watches are also considered safe for pacemaker wearers, as their minimal electromagnetic output is usually too weak to cause disruption.

Modern smartwatches and fitness trackers incorporate more advanced technology, leading to greater consideration for pacemaker wearers. Most smartwatches, when worn on the wrist, are generally considered safe, with their electromagnetic fields weak and localized. Studies indicate that the risk of interference is low, especially when a normal wrist distance is maintained from the pacemaker implant site.

Some smartwatches and fitness trackers utilize bioimpedance technology, which sends small, imperceptible electrical currents through the body. Research suggests this specific technology could potentially interfere with pacemakers, and some experts advise caution or avoidance. Additionally, smartwatches containing strong magnets, particularly those used for wireless charging, may temporarily affect a pacemaker’s operation by triggering a “magnet mode” if brought too close.

Understanding Potential Interference

Concerns about electronic devices and pacemakers relate to electromagnetic interference (EMI). EMI occurs when external electromagnetic fields disrupt the normal operation of electronic devices. For pacemakers, EMI can potentially mimic the heart’s natural electrical signals, causing the device to misinterpret rhythms. This could lead to inappropriate or missed pulse delivery.

The strength of the electromagnetic field and the proximity of the electronic device to the pacemaker are key factors influencing the potential for interference. Stronger fields or closer distances increase the likelihood of disruption. Modern pacemakers are designed with increased resilience to EMI compared to older models, which helps mitigate risks from common electronics.

Important Considerations for Pacemaker Wearers

Maintaining a reasonable distance between electronic devices and the pacemaker is a primary recommendation. It is advised to keep any electronic device, including watches, at least 6 inches away from the pacemaker implant site. For devices with wireless charging capabilities, a distance of 12 inches is often suggested while charging due to stronger magnetic fields.

Pacemaker wearers should be aware of any unusual symptoms that might indicate potential interference. Symptoms such as dizziness, palpitations, or lightheadedness could suggest a disruption in pacemaker function. If such symptoms occur, moving away from the electronic device and promptly contact a healthcare professional.
